Rolling Stone Magazine's Issue 389 from February 17, 1983, titled "Michael Jackson: Life As A Man," is a landmark edition that delves into the personal and professional life of the pop sensation. The cover signals a departure from his youthful image, reflecting a pivotal moment in his career. The feature article and interviews provide intimate insights into Jackson's evolution as an artist and a man, capturing his charisma and impact on both music and culture. The edition is a significant and collectible portrayal of Michael Jackson during a transformative period in the early 1980s.
